Your wrote:

>Check (on the remote machine)

>- the permissions on the /var/spool directory and
>subdirs

Many many thanks for your helpful hint.  Yes, indeed the subdir in
/var/spool which in the remote system is laser4 had rwx only for user
and no rx permission for group and others.  By giving the rx permission
for all, it solved the problem.  Thanks again.
